    LWJ, UWJ, Armstrong, Gothics Feb-4

    Hiked in from the Garden on Friday. Tented at Wolf Jaw Lean-to. Snow levels varied from a trace at the Garden; 3-4 inches at Lean-to; 3-4 feet on the summits and in the cols between the peaks. Ice coating over all trails. Equipment: Recommend Micro Spikes on all approaches Full crampons needed...

    Cliff and Allan in winter 3-day

    In the summer it would be tough, but depending on snow conditions you might be able to do it. First Day: I would hike in to Flowed Lands EARLY. Set up camp and head to Cliff. Second Day: Day Hike Allen down the Hanging Spear Falls trail from Flowed Lands. Third Day: Crawl back to Upper Works...
